Facilities Ticket — Cleaning Crew Access, Brindle Annex

For new starters handling evening lock-up: the Sorano Cleaning crew arrives nightly at 21:30 via the annex side door. Check their rota sheet, note arrival in the log, and ensure the storeroom is relocked afterward. To let them through the side door, enter the access code below.

badge for yaweg-hafog: bdg-GX-6

- [ ] **Spreadsheet export memory check** — Run the big-workbook export (50k rows, merged cells) on Tallyhouse staging and confirm peak RSS stays under 1.2GB. Last release we crept past that and the pods got OOM-killed mid-export, which was not a fun Friday. Streaming writer should keep it flat now. Log the peak number next to the build below.

pipeline stamp: htk3_69f

**Vendor note: Inkmill markdown pipeline**

Rendering for Parchway docs is outsourced to Inkmill under an annual contract, renewing each March. They handle sanitization and PDF export; we own the upload queue. SLA: 4-hour response on rendering failures. Escalate only after two failed retries. Their support desk is reachable at the address below.

billing contact of hahaf-baguf = zorael.tammir.jorius@sivrelhq.internal